Web12 apr. 2024 · Instructions. Add coconut oil to the bottom of the Instant Pot, then add oats, milk, sea salt and maple syrup. Do not stir. Cook on high pressure for 2 minutes, then let the pressure naturally release for 10 minutes. Release the remaining pressure, then divide among 4 bowls. WebTo cook Quaker oats on the stove, you will need 1 cup of oats and 2 cups of water. You can also add a pinch of salt if you like. 1. Add the oats and water to a saucepan. 2. Bring the mixture to a boil over medium-high heat. 3. Reduce the heat to low and simmer for about 10 minutes, or until the oats are cooked through. 4.
